Directions
- Preheat the oven to 180C/350F degrees. Whisk the egg whites until stiff. In another bowl, blend the flax seed, baking powder, salt and oil. Add the egg yolks, water and apple cider vinegar. Gently fold the egg whites into the flaxseed mixture. Pour into a greased loaf pan and bake for 30 minutes until firm and golden. Eat and enjoy!
